Understanding JPEG: What Does It Mean?

JPEG stands for Joint Photographic Experts Group, the name of the committee that created this image compression standard in 1992. The main goal of the JPEG format is to reduce the file size of images, making it easier to store and transmit them without significantly compromising the image quality.


The Core Features of JPEG

JPEG is highly versatile, which is why it has become the go-to image format. Here are some core features of JPEG that make it a popular choice:

1. Compression Capabilities

JPEG uses lossy compression, meaning that when the image is saved in this format, some of the data is discarded to reduce the file size. This allows for smaller file sizes, which are easier to upload, download, and share online.

However, lossy compression means that some of the original image quality is lost during the process. But with a well-balanced compression ratio, the loss in quality is often negligible to the naked eye.

2. Wide Compatibility

Almost all devices and platforms support JPEG files, including smartphones, cameras, computers, and web browsers. This makes JPEG a universally accepted format for displaying images across various mediums.

3. Color Range

JPEG supports 24-bit color, which means it can display approximately 16.7 million colors. This makes it suitable for full-color photographs and images with gradients and complex patterns.

4. Flexible Image Quality

When saving images as JPEG files, you can choose the level of compression and, therefore, the image quality. Higher compression results in smaller file sizes but reduced image quality, while lower compression preserves better image quality but results in larger file sizes.


Where Is JPEG Used?

JPEG has countless uses in both personal and professional settings, including:

  • Photography: Most digital cameras and smartphones use JPEG as the default format for saving images.
  • Web Design: JPEG’s smaller file sizes make it ideal for websites to ensure fast loading times without compromising image quality.
  • Social Media: Platforms like Instagram, Facebook, and Twitter widely use JPEG for image uploads and sharing.
  • Email Attachments: JPEG files are smaller, making them easier to send via email without exceeding attachment size limits.

Advantages and Disadvantages of JPEG

While JPEG is an incredibly versatile format, it’s important to recognize both its strengths and weaknesses.

Advantages:

  • Reduced File Size: JPEG significantly reduces image file size, making it easier to store and share.
  • Universal Support: Nearly all devices and programs can read and display JPEG files.
  • Good for Web Use: Optimized for online use, ensuring images load quickly on websites and social media.

Disadvantages:

  • Lossy Compression: Each time a JPEG is saved, some image data is lost, leading to a reduction in image quality.
  • Not Ideal for Graphic Design: JPEGs are not well-suited for images that need to retain sharp lines and solid colors, like logos or illustrations.
  • Limited Editing: Repeated editing and saving of JPEG images can degrade their quality over time.

How Does JPEG Differ from Other Image Formats?

While JPEG is one of the most popular image formats, it’s not the only one. Here’s how JPEG compares with other common formats:

  • PNG (Portable Network Graphics): Unlike JPEG, PNG uses lossless compression, which retains all image data, making it ideal for images that need to preserve quality after editing or resizing. PNG is also better suited for images with transparent backgrounds.
  • GIF (Graphics Interchange Format): GIFs are limited to 256 colors and are often used for animations. JPEG supports a much broader color range, making it more suitable for high-quality photos.
  • RAW: RAW images contain unprocessed data straight from a camera’s sensor, making them much larger in size but with no loss in image quality. JPEG, by contrast, compresses the image and is much smaller in size.

Frequently Asked Questions (FAQs)

1. What does JPEG stand for?

JPEG stands for Joint Photographic Experts Group, the organization that created the standard for this image format.

2. Is JPEG a lossy or lossless format?

JPEG is a lossy format, which means some data is lost during compression to reduce the file size.

3. What is the difference between JPEG and PNG?

JPEG uses lossy compression and is best for photographs, while PNG uses lossless compression and is better for images that require transparency or need to maintain sharp lines and edges.

4. Can JPEG files be edited?

Yes, JPEG files can be edited, but be cautious. Each time a JPEG file is edited and re-saved, it loses some quality due to its lossy compression.

5. Is JPEG good for printing photos?

Yes, JPEG is widely used for printing, especially for casual purposes. However, if you need the highest quality for professional printing, a lossless format like TIFF or RAW may be better.

6. Why do photographers often use RAW instead of JPEG?

Photographers often prefer RAW because it retains all the image data captured by the camera, offering greater flexibility in post-processing. JPEG, on the other hand, compresses the image, discarding some data to save space.
